# 在Shell中调用MySQL SQL的完整教程
## 流程概述
在这里,我们将讨论如何在Shell中调用MySQL SQL并执行查询。整个流程分为几个步骤,具体如下表所示:
| 步骤 | 描述 |
|-----------------|-----------------------------|
| 1. 安装MySQL
原创
2024-10-26 06:59:14
25阅读
PS:因公司java服务有时候会出现,进程还在,但是无法正常做业务,通过该脚本对http服务状态进行检测,如果返回http状态码异常,或指定时间没有返回,则重启服务。一、通过shell脚本检测服务状态。#!/bin/bash
#设置变量,url为你需要检测的目标网站的网址(IP或域名)
url=http://192.168.1.1:8080/SKDo
#重启脚本的位置,这里可替换为你程序自定义
转载
2024-07-26 10:33:52
90阅读
# 使用 Shell 调用 MySQL 执行 SQL 文件的详解
在日常的数据库管理工作中,您可能需要执行一系列 SQL 语句。这些 SQL 语句通常存储在一个 `.sql` 文件中。为了简化操作,我们可以使用 Shell 脚本来调用 MySQL,自动执行这些 SQL 文件。本文将详细介绍如何实现这一过程,并提供代码示例。
## 一、准备工作
在开始之前,请确保您已经在系统中安装了 MySQ
# 使用 Shell 调用 Spark SQL 的详细指南
Apache Spark 是一个快速的通用计算引擎,支撑大规模的数据处理。而 Spark SQL 则是一种用于结构化数据的处理 API,可以通过 SQL 查询来对数据进行多方面的操作。在某些情况下,我们需要通过 Shell 脚本调用 Spark SQL,本文将详细介绍这个过程,并提供相关示例和关系图。
## 为什么选择 Shell 与
在日常大数据处理工作中,如何通过 shell 脚本调用 Spark SQL 是一个常见的需求。今天,我会详细讲解从环境准备到实战应用的全过程。掌握这个技能后,你可以方便地在自动化脚本中利用 Spark SQL 处理大数据,简化工作流程。
## 环境准备
首先,我们要确保系统的环境准备就绪。我们需要安装 Apache Spark 和 Hadoop,并确保它们之间的兼容性。以下是适用于不同操作系统
## 实现Mysql调用shell的流程
为了实现Mysql调用shell,我们可以按照以下步骤进行操作:
| 步骤 | 操作 |
| --- | --- |
| 1 | 创建一个数据库触发器 |
| 2 | 配置触发器,在触发器中调用Mysql的shell命令 |
| 3 | 测试触发器,验证是否能成功调用shell命令 |
下面我将详细介绍每一步需要做的事情以及相应的代码。
### 步
原创
2023-08-03 04:59:45
138阅读
mysql -u${用户名} -p -e"SQL语句"; # 确认之后输入密码即可下面举个例子:[root@ecs-s3-large-2-linux-20200627183241 ~]# mysql -uzhoujl -p -e"show processlist";
Enter password:
+----+--------+-----------+------+---------+-----
转载
2020-12-29 15:40:00
157阅读
在Linux系统中,使用Shell脚本调用SQL脚本是一种常见的操作。通过这种方式,用户可以快速方便地执行数据库操作,例如创建表、插入数据或查询信息。在这篇文章中,我们将介绍如何使用Linux Shell脚本来调用SQL脚本,并且探讨一些常见的问题和解决方法。
首先,我们需要准备一个SQL脚本文件,该文件包含了我们想要执行的数据库操作。假设我们已经创建了一个名为“create_table.sql
原创
2024-04-26 10:38:42
144阅读
Hive SQL是一种基于Hadoop的分布式数据仓库工具,它提供了类似于SQL的查询语言,用于对存储在Hadoop文件系统上的数据进行查询和分析。在某些情况下,我们可能需要在Hive SQL中调用Shell脚本,以实现一些特定的功能。本文将详细介绍如何在Hive SQL中调用Shell脚本,并提供一些示例代码。
### 1. 使用UDF实现Shell调用
Hive提供了一种名为UDF(Use
原创
2024-07-25 06:49:32
49阅读
文章目录1.1 MySQL实例的部署情况1.2 MySQL实例的启停方式1.3 MySQL启动脚本的内容 1.1 MySQL实例的部署情况## mysql程序和mysql实例的规划
/data/mysql/apps # mysql程序就部署在此目录下
## mysql 3306实例的规划目录
/data/mysql
|___3306
|___data
转载
2024-10-03 13:45:43
17阅读
### 实现mysql触发调用shell的流程
| 步骤 | 操作 |
| ------ | ------ |
| 步骤一 | 创建一个新的数据库 |
| 步骤二 | 创建一个触发器 |
| 步骤三 | 在触发器中调用shell脚本 |
| 步骤四 | 触发触发器 |
### 操作指南
#### 步骤一:创建一个新的数据库
首先,我们需要创建一个新的数据库来存储数据和触发器。可以使用MyS
原创
2024-01-16 07:34:46
289阅读
# 使用MySQL CLI调用Shell脚本
## 简介
MySQL是一款常用的关系型数据库管理系统,它提供了一个命令行界面(CLI)来与数据库进行交互。除了执行SQL查询和管理数据库之外,MySQL CLI还提供了一些功能来调用外部的Shell脚本。在本文中,我们将介绍如何使用MySQL CLI来调用Shell脚本,并提供一些实际的代码示例。
## 调用Shell脚本的方法
MySQL
原创
2023-08-11 19:24:07
82阅读
/opt/backup_online.sh
#!/bin/bash
#功能说明:本功能用于备份数据库
#数据库用户名
dbuser='root'
#数据库密码
dbpasswd='zLaaa'
#数据库名,可以定义多个数据库,中间以空格隔开,如:test test1 test2
dbname='adb bdb '
#备份时间
backtime=`date +%Y%m%d%H%M%S`
#日志
# Shell调用MySQL脚本的全面指南
在数据库管理和应用开发中,MySQL是一个广泛使用的关系数据库管理系统。将数据库操作脚本化,能够提高工作效率和保证操作的一致性。而通过Shell脚本来调用MySQL脚本,是一个常用且有效的方法。在这篇文章中,我们将介绍如何在Linux环境中通过Shell调用MySQL脚本,并提供相关的示例代码。同时,我们还将使用Mermaid.js展示旅行图和甘特图,
原创
2024-08-26 03:29:32
45阅读
老兵修改看了N.E.V.E.R的文章,马上在本机测试,成功了。下面是作者的原文:backup a shell最早想到利用数据库系统来写文件大约MySQL下面的事情吧,我记得有篇经典的贴子是讲利用TCP反弹结合输入法漏洞入侵的,第一步,也是很重要的一步就是利用了MySQL导出表到文件获得了一个web上的shell。ACCESS功能不那么强大,有注入漏洞的时候也不能直接获得执行任何命令的权限,就不说了
对于一些周期性事务,我们可以在Linux下,使用shell脚本调用mysql数据库存储过程,并设置定时任务。本来是要mysql数据库中创建事件任务来,定时执行存储过程,做数据传输的。。。使用crontab来定时执行,调用存储过程。实现这个数据传输分为两步:第一步:编写shell脚本调用mysql数据库存储过程,如下:#!/bin/bash50 8 * * * sh /home/bgop/hao/d
转载
2024-08-08 00:07:42
227阅读
对于一些周期性事务,我们可以在Linux下,使用shell脚本调用mysql数据库存储过程,并设置定时任务。本来是要mysql数据库中创建事件任务来,定时执行存储过程,做数据传输的。。。使用crontab来定时执行,调用存储过程。 实现这个数据传输分为两步:第一步:编写shell脚本调用mysql数据库存储过程,如下: #!/bin/bash
# 50 8 * * * sh /home
转载
2023-08-23 16:11:57
869阅读
渗透思路千万条,只要有一条通往成功获取webshell的道路即可,所以不必一定纠结于必须要使用sqlmap一. sqlmap获取webshell及提权常见命令1. sqlmap常见获取webshell的相关命令(1) MSSQL判断是否是DBA权限--is-dba(2) 数据库交互模式shell--sql-shell(3) 操作系统交互命令--os-cmd=net user 这里一般是Window
转载
2023-10-12 19:14:57
24阅读
Linux/Unix shell脚本中调用或执行SQL,RMAN 等为自动化作业以及多次反复执行提供了极大的便利,因此通过Linux/Unix shell来完成Oracle的相关工作,也是DBA必不可少的技能之一。本文针对Linux/Unix shell脚本调用sql, rman 脚本给出了相关示例。一、由shell脚本调用sql,rman脚本1、shell脚本调用sql脚本
#首先编辑sql文
转载
2024-02-28 12:44:28
238阅读
以前一直用SQLserver ,执行SQL脚本,我们一般在查询分析器中直接打开脚本文件执行即可。 最近学习《Mysql完全手册》(Vikram Vaswani著,原名:The complete Reference),也没找到书中关于如何在客户端中执行SQL脚本的,也许有,但我没看到。 遂查阅Google大神,获得相关方法,故记录下来,备查。 也算上是开始真正学习MYSQL数据库
转载
2023-06-26 21:01:52
113阅读